Robbie Williams has caused outrage among 1D fans (Picture: ITV)

Robbie Williams has casually infuriated the entire One Direction fandom after saying his X Factor act are leaps and bounds ahead of them.

The 44-year-old singer was full of praise for his act United Vibe, who performed Niall Horans Slow Hands in the first live show.

Ayda Field, however, took the opportunity to throw some shade at her husband Robbie – taking a pop over his history with quitting Take That.

Louis Tomlinson wasnt having any of it (Picture: ITV)

After the performance, Ayda said: You guys just got together. I thought that was a great song choice and you know what, you guys get on really well which is important.

The worst thing in a group is when one person thinks theyre better than everybody else.

With all four judges sharing awkward glances, Robbie decided to divert the shade onto One Direction member Louis Tomlinson.

Robbie said: I feel like a proud dad. I dont know what these two are on about.

In the early days of Take That when wed been together for a month or six weeks, however long it is that youre together now, you are leaps and bounds beyond us.

And also youre leaps and bounds beyond One Direction at this point.

Listen girls, get on board, these boys are going places. Go with them.

And just like that, an entire fandom erupted into overdrive.
